Basic facts about this digital color

In the Register's classification, #AAC07D belongs to the Chartreuse Color Family, featuring Mild Saturation and Very Light brightness. The mix behind it: rgb(170, 192, 125) — 66.7% red, 75.3% green, 49% blue; the print equivalent is CMYK 9 / 0 / 26 / 25. Curious how these numbers work? Read our RGB color codes guide.

The color #AAC07D reads as a softly balanced zesty chartreuse and floats near the light end of the scale. Expect to see shades like this in clean interfaces where content needs room to breathe. In The Official Register of Color Names it is almost identical to Caper (#AFC182). Nearby in the Register you will also find Pastel Avocado (#B1C086) and Tan Green (#A9BE70).

The recipe behind #AAC07D is rgb(170, 192, 125), with green as the dominant ingredient. If you plan to put text on a #AAC07D background, choose black — the contrast ratio is 10.5:1 (passing WCAG AAA), while white manages only 2.0:1. #AAC07D has no official name yet. #AAC07D color harmonies

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.

Complementary

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.

Complementary color schemes

Split complementary

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.

Split complementary color scheme

Analogous

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.

Analogous color scheme

Triadic

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.

Triadic color scheme

Tetradic

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.

Tetradic color scheme

Square

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.
